Peanut Butter Balls
- 12 cup butter
- 12 ounces crunchy peanut butter
- 1 (1 lb) box confectioners' sugar
- 3 cups Rice Krispies
- 1 (24 ounce) bag milk chocolate chips
- 4 ounces hershey plain chocolate candy bars
- 13 lb canning paraffin wax (about 1/3 of a bar paraffin)
- In a large pot melt the stick of butter over medium-low heat, take pot off of stove, add powdered sugar, peanut butter and cereal.
- Using your hands, form the peanut butter mixture into balls (you may want to refrigerate after forming).
- Melt chocolate chips, chocolate bar and paraffin wax in a double boiler.
- Dip balls (I usually use a fork to dip them so the chocolate runs out through the tines) into chocolate and put on wax paper.
- Let the balls harden in the refrigerator for at least an hour before serving.
- Make sure to store them in a cool place.
